THE The Miami Dolphins are looking to move forward after a tough Week 2, but face the tall task of doing so in a road game against the Seattle Seahawks.
Three-year backup Skylar Thompson will lead the Dolphins after Tua Tagovailoa suffered a concussion last week in a blowout loss.
The Seahawks are 2-0, albeit against below-average competition, and have won their last two meetings with the Dolphins in 2016 and 2020.
Fans in attendance will be able to watch the Dolphins’ Week 3 away game on their local CBS network and can stream it on fuboTV. Kevin Harlan will provide live coverage of the game in the booth and Trent Green will provide analysis.
